h5如何制作网页

制作H5网页首先需要掌握HTML5和CSS3基础,使用如Sublime Text或Visual Studio Code等编辑器编写代码。设计网页结构时,利用HTML标签定义内容,CSS样式美化界面。加入JavaScript实现交互功能。测试兼容性,确保在不同设备上显示正常。最后,部署到服务器即可上线。

imagesource from: pexels

目录

H5网页制作的入门与提升

在数字时代,H5网页作为一种轻量级、跨平台的应用,已经成为展示品牌形象、推广产品和互动交流的重要工具。H5网页的制作涉及HTML5和CSS3的基础知识,以及使用编辑器编写代码的基本流程。了解H5网页制作的重要性,掌握相关的技术,对于广大互联网从业者来说,无疑是提升自身技能和竞争力的关键。那么,如何系统地学习H5网页制作,成为一名专业人才呢?本文将从基础知识、设计、交互和部署等方面,为大家提供一个全面的学习路线图。

在接下来的文章中,我们将详细讲解H5网页制作的相关知识。首先,我们将探讨HTML5和CSS3的基本标签和用法,帮助读者掌握构建网页结构的核心技能。随后,我们将介绍如何使用CSS3进行样式应用与美化,以及如何选择合适的编辑器(如Sublime Text和Visual Studio Code)来编写代码。接着,我们将深入探讨如何设计网页结构,包括使用HTML标签定义内容、合理布局网页结构以及使用语义化标签等技巧。在此基础上,我们将介绍如何通过CSS样式的高级应用、JavaScript实现动态交互和响应式设计的实现方法来美化界面和提升用户体验。最后,我们将详细介绍如何进行跨浏览器兼容性测试、移动设备适配测试,以及将H5网页部署到服务器上的步骤。

本文旨在为广大互联网从业者提供一套系统、全面的H5网页制作学习指南,帮助大家快速入门并不断提升技术水平。通过学习本文,读者将能够:

  • 掌握HTML5和CSS3的基本标签和用法,构建网页结构;
  • 利用CSS3进行样式应用与美化,提升网页视觉效果;
  • 使用Sublime Text或Visual Studio Code等编辑器高效编写代码;
  • 设计合理的网页结构,提升用户体验;
  • 通过CSS样式的高级应用、JavaScript实现动态交互和响应式设计;
  • 进行跨浏览器兼容性测试和移动设备适配测试;
  • 将H5网页成功部署到服务器上。

让我们共同走进H5网页制作的世界,开启一段精彩的学习之旅!

一、H5网页制作的基础知识

随着互联网技术的不断发展,HTML5和CSS3成为了网页制作的重要工具。掌握这些基础知识,是制作H5网页的第一步。

1、HTML5的基本标签和用法

HTML5是当前网页制作的主流技术,它提供了更多功能强大的标签,使得网页制作更加便捷。以下是一些常见的HTML5标签及其用法:

标签 用法

定义网页的头部区域,通常包含网站标志、导航菜单等

定义一个独立的、完整的、可以独立分发或引用的内容块

定义文档中的一个章节

定义导航链接的部分

定义媒体内容及其标题
定义

元素的标题

2、CSS3的样式应用与美化

CSS3是用于描述HTML文档样式的语言,它提供了丰富的样式效果,如阴影、圆角、过渡效果等。以下是一些CSS3的基本用法:

选择器 用法
.class 选择具有特定类的元素
#id 选择具有特定ID的元素
* 选择所有元素
.parent > .child 选择父元素下的直接子元素
[attribute] 选择具有特定属性的元素

3、常用编辑器介绍:Sublime Text与Visual Studio Code

在编写H5网页代码时,选择合适的编辑器至关重要。以下介绍两款常用的编辑器:

编辑器 优点 缺点
Sublime Text 界面简洁、功能强大、插件丰富 免费版本功能有限
Visual Studio Code 开源、跨平台、集成度高 学习曲线较陡峭

总结:掌握HTML5和CSS3基础知识,选择合适的编辑器,是制作H5网页的基础。在后续的学习中,我们将进一步探索H5网页的设计与实现。

二、设计网页结构

1、使用HTML标签定义网页内容

在H5网页制作中,HTML标签是构建网页内容的基础。合理运用HTML5的各种标签,能够有效地组织网页结构,提升用户体验。以下是一些常用的HTML5标签及其用法:

标签名称 用途

定义网页的页眉,通常包含网站标志、导航链接等

定义网站的导航链接

用于定义独立的内容区域,如博客文章、论坛帖子等

用于定义文档中的一个章节

用于定义侧边栏内容,如相关链接、广告等

定义网页的页脚,通常包含版权信息、联系方式等

2、合理布局网页结构

网页布局是决定用户体验的关键因素之一。以下是一些常见的网页布局方式:

布局方式 描述
流体布局 页面元素宽度自适应屏幕宽度,适合移动端
固定布局 页面元素宽度固定,适合桌面端
弹性布局 页面元素宽度自适应屏幕宽度,但元素间距保持不变
响应式布局 页面在不同设备上具有不同的布局,适应各种屏幕尺寸

3、语义化标签的使用技巧

语义化标签有助于搜索引擎更好地理解网页内容,提高网站SEO效果。以下是一些语义化标签的使用技巧:

  • 使用正确的标签表示页面元素,如使用

    等标签表示标题,使用

    标签表示段落等。

  • 避免滥用标签,如不要将非标题内容包裹在

    标签中。

  • 合理使用嵌套标签,使页面结构更加清晰。

通过以上三个方面的内容,我们可以更好地设计H5网页的结构,为用户提供优质的浏览体验。在后续的章节中,我们将进一步探讨如何美化界面与交互设计,以及如何进行测试与部署。

三、美化界面与交互设计

H3:1、CSS样式的高级应用

在H5网页制作中,CSS样式的高级应用是提升网页视觉效果的关键。通过学习CSS的盒模型、浮动、定位、渐变、阴影等高级特性,可以使网页界面更加美观和生动。以下是一些CSS样式的高级应用实例:

CSS特性 应用实例
盒模型 设置元素的margin、padding、border等属性,控制元素布局空间
浮动 实现多列布局、广告横幅、图片环绕等效果
定位 通过绝对定位、相对定位、固定定位等实现元素的精确定位
渐变 实现背景、边框、文字等的颜色渐变效果
阴影 为元素添加阴影效果,增强立体感

H3:2、JavaScript实现动态交互

JavaScript是H5网页实现动态交互的核心技术。通过JavaScript可以编写脚本,实现与用户的交互,如响应点击事件、表单验证、数据交互等。以下是一些JavaScript实现动态交互的实例:

JavaScript特性 应用实例
事件监听 为按钮、图片等元素添加点击、鼠标悬停等事件监听器,实现交互效果
表单验证 对用户输入的数据进行验证,确保数据的有效性
数据交互 通过AJAX技术实现前后端数据交互,动态更新页面内容

H3:3、响应式设计的实现方法

随着移动设备的普及,响应式设计已成为H5网页制作的重要趋势。响应式设计可以让网页在不同设备上呈现出最佳效果。以下是一些实现响应式设计的方法:

响应式设计方法 应用实例
媒体查询 通过CSS媒体查询,根据不同设备屏幕尺寸应用不同的样式
Flexbox布局 使用Flexbox布局实现元素在容器中的灵活排列
网格系统 使用栅格系统实现网页元素在不同设备上的自适应布局

通过以上方法,我们可以实现H5网页的美化界面与交互设计,为用户提供更加丰富、生动的浏览体验。

四、测试与部署

1. 跨浏览器兼容性测试

在H5网页制作过程中,确保跨浏览器兼容性是至关重要的。不同的浏览器对HTML5和CSS3的支持程度不同,因此需要进行测试,确保网页在各种浏览器上都能正常显示。

以下是一些常见的浏览器兼容性测试工具:

工具名称 描述
BrowserStack 提供各种浏览器和操作系统的模拟环境,方便进行跨浏览器测试
CrossBrowserTesting 提供多种浏览器和设备,支持自动化测试,方便批量测试
BrowserLab 测试网页在不同浏览器和设备上的渲染效果

2. 移动设备适配测试

随着移动设备的普及,越来越多的用户使用手机或平板电脑浏览网页。因此,在H5网页制作过程中,需要确保网页在移动设备上的良好表现。

以下是一些移动设备适配测试方法:

方法 描述
响应式设计 根据屏幕尺寸自动调整网页布局和内容,确保在不同设备上显示良好
网页预览工具 使用移动设备预览工具,如Chrome开发者工具中的设备模拟功能
手机浏览器测试 使用手机浏览器测试网页在真实设备上的表现

3. 部署到服务器的步骤

将H5网页部署到服务器,使其能够上线,需要以下步骤:

步骤 描述
准备空间 选择合适的云服务器或虚拟主机空间
传输文件 将H5网页文件上传到服务器,可以使用FTP或SCP等方式
配置服务器 根据需要配置服务器,如设置PHP、MySQL等
测试网站 在服务器上测试网页,确保能够正常访问
上线发布 将网站设置成公网IP,使其他人能够访问

通过以上步骤,您就可以完成H5网页的制作,并在各种设备和浏览器上展现出色的表现。同时,不断学习和实践,将使您在H5网页制作领域更加出色。

结语:迈向专业H5网页制作的下一步

在H5网页制作的道路上,我们不仅学习了HTML5和CSS3的基础知识,还掌握了设计网页结构、美化界面与交互设计以及测试与部署的技巧。这些关键点为我们打开了一扇通往专业H5网页制作的大门。然而,学习永无止境,为了进一步提升自己的技能,我们应当继续深入学习与实践。

以下是一些建议的学习资源,可以帮助您在H5网页制作的道路上更进一步:

  1. 在线教程与课程:您可以访问一些知名的在线教育平台,如慕课网、网易云课堂等,那里有丰富的H5网页制作教程和课程,适合不同水平的学习者。

  2. 专业书籍:选择一本适合自己水平的H5网页制作书籍,系统地学习相关知识,如《HTML5与CSS3权威指南》、《JavaScript高级程序设计》等。

  3. 实践项目:通过参与实际项目,将所学知识应用到实践中,不断积累经验。您可以尝试制作一些个人网站或参与开源项目。

  4. 交流与分享:加入一些H5网页制作相关的论坛和社群,与其他开发者交流心得,分享经验,共同进步。

总之,掌握H5网页制作的关键点后,我们要敢于挑战自我,不断学习与实践,才能在H5网页制作的道路上越走越远。相信自己,相信未来,让我们一起迈向专业H5网页制作的下一步吧!

常见问题

1、H5网页制作需要哪些基础知识?

H5网页制作需要掌握HTML5和CSS3的基础知识。HTML5是构建网页内容的核心,了解其基本标签和用法至关重要。CSS3则用于美化网页,包括样式设置、布局调整等。此外,了解JavaScript可以帮助实现网页的动态交互效果。

2、如何选择合适的编辑器?

选择合适的编辑器主要考虑个人喜好和实际需求。目前市面上流行的编辑器有Sublime Text、Visual Studio Code等。Sublime Text以简洁的界面和高效的代码编辑功能著称,而Visual Studio Code则拥有强大的插件生态和社区支持。建议根据自己的操作习惯和项目需求进行选择。

3、网页兼容性测试有哪些注意事项?

进行网页兼容性测试时,需要注意以下几点:

  • 测试不同浏览器和版本,确保网页在各种环境下都能正常显示。
  • 检查网页在不同分辨率的设备上是否适配,特别是移动端设备。
  • 注意网页的加载速度,优化图片、CSS和JavaScript等资源,提高用户体验。

4、如何部署H5网页到服务器?

部署H5网页到服务器一般包括以下步骤:

  1. 选择合适的服务器提供商,购买域名和虚拟主机。
  2. 将本地网页文件上传到服务器,可以使用FTP软件进行上传。
  3. 配置服务器环境,如设置正确的服务器文件路径、数据库连接等。
  4. 验证网页链接,确保网页能够正常访问。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/79324.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-14 04:37
Next 2025-06-14 04:37

相关推荐

  • 如何让其他平台收录

    要让其他平台收录你的内容,首先确保内容高质量且原创,平台更青睐有价值的信息。优化标题和描述,嵌入相关关键词,提高搜索引擎的抓取概率。其次,利用平台API或提交链接,主动推送内容到目标平台。最后,保持更新频率,增强内容时效性,提升被收录的机会。

    2025-06-13
    0104
  • 如何整理搜集的网站

    整理搜集的网站需分三步:首先,分类归纳,按主题或用途将网站分组;其次,使用工具如书签管理器或笔记软件,集中存储网址;最后,定期更新和清理,确保信息有效性。这样不仅能提高查找效率,还能避免信息过载。

  • 如何动态域名解析

    动态域名解析是实现远程访问的关键技术。首先,选择可靠的动态DNS服务商,如花生壳或No-IP。注册账号并获取动态域名。接着,在路由器或服务器上配置动态DNS客户端,确保域名实时更新IP地址。最后,通过DDNS客户端保持IP与域名的同步,实现稳定访问。

  • 网页面布局有哪些

    网页面布局包括固定布局、流式布局、响应式布局和弹性布局。固定布局宽度固定,适合特定分辨率;流式布局宽度自适应,兼容性强;响应式布局根据设备自动调整,用户体验佳;弹性布局基于比例分配,灵活度高。合理选择布局能提升网站性能和用户满意度。

    2025-06-16
    0135
  • ps如何去阴影

    在Photoshop中去阴影,首先打开图片,选择‘图像 > 调整 > 阴影/高光’工具。调整‘阴影’滑块,增加阴影区域的亮度。若需更精细调整,使用‘画笔工具’配合‘图层蒙版’,选择较亮的颜色在阴影区域涂抹。最后,适当调整‘对比度’和‘饱和度’,使图片整体和谐。

  • 怎么增强客户的信任度

    增强客户信任度,首先要提供高质量的产品和服务。确保每次交付都超出预期,建立良好的口碑。其次,保持透明和诚信,及时沟通问题,避免隐瞒。再次,重视客户反馈,积极回应并改进。最后,建立长期关系,通过定期跟进和个性化服务,让客户感受到重视。

    2025-06-11
    04
  • js如何弹出页面

    在JavaScript中,使用`alert()`函数可以轻松实现页面弹出。例如,`alert('Hello, World!');`会在浏览器中显示一个包含文本的对话框。适用于快速通知用户,但注意不要过度使用,以免影响用户体验。

  • 内容平台包括哪些

    内容平台涵盖多种类型,如社交媒体(如微博、微信)、视频平台(如抖音、B站)、博客平台(如WordPress、 Medium)、问答社区(如知乎、Quora)等。这些平台各有特色,满足不同用户的需求,从信息获取到娱乐休闲,全方位覆盖。

    2025-06-15
    0406
  • 一次可以备案多少域名

    根据ICP备案规定,一个主体可以备案多个域名,但具体数量因地区和备案服务商而异。一般来说,中小企业或个人网站一次备案1-5个域名较为常见,大型企业或机构可备案更多。建议提前咨询当地备案服务商了解具体限制。

    2025-06-11
    06

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注